#c57b63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c57b63 is composed of 77.3% red, 48.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.6% magenta, 49.7%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 14.7 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 58%. #c57b63 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6c6 with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#c57b63 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#c57b63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c57b63 has RGB values of R:197, G:123,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.5,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12942179.

Shades and Tints of #c57b63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#faf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c57b63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c908c is the less saturated color, while #ff5e29 is the most saturated one.
